89-Year-Old Gary Player Offers Beautiful Perspective on Life at the Masters
At the 2025 Masters, golf legends turned out for all the festivities to offer their career and life advice to the current crop of PGA hopefuls.
Legends like 89-year-old Gary Player offered some perspective that may have seemed a little dark on the surface but was wholesome and honest.
He started by responding to a question about Tiger Woods eating Arby’s, to which he answered that he still refuses to eat fast food. He then transitioned into talking about how love is precious and – brace yourself – either you or your spouse is going to kick the bucket first.
Yep, he said that with the cheerful honesty of a wise old man who’s seen it all. His overall message turned out to be beautiful. Reminding us to not waste time, to hug your loved ones, to take care of your body, and for goodness’ sake, skip the fries.
